If you want your computer to perform day in and out at high levels, make sure you dust out the interior every week. The case can easily be removed so you can use compressed air to spray out the dust. That way, the machine stays clean and the fan stays functional.

There are two different types of hard drives, and then the choices branch out from those two options. The HDD hard drive is the standard one that most people are familiar with, and the SSD is the newer version of a hard drive. SSD drives will be faster but also hold less data and cost more.

Some computers actually come with multiple video cards. The cards are set up to work together. That is helpful for multiple monitors and high resolution gaming, but if that’s not something you’re into, one video card is enough.
